| AddButton(DWORD commandId, LPCWSTR caption, BOOL hasSubMenu, INT iconId, DWORD_PTR buttonData, BOOL last) | CMenuToolbarBase | protected |
| AddPlaceholder() | CMenuToolbarBase | protected |
| AddSeparator(BOOL last) | CMenuToolbarBase | protected |
| BeforeCancelPopup() | CMenuToolbarBase | |
| CancelCurrentPopup() | CMenuToolbarBase | |
| ChangeHotItem(CMenuToolbarBase *toolbar, INT item, DWORD dwFlags) | CMenuToolbarBase | |
| ChangePopupItem(CMenuToolbarBase *toolbar, INT item) | CMenuToolbarBase | |
| ChangeTrackedItem(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L &bHandled) | CMenuToolbarBase | private |
| ClearToolbar() | CMenuToolbarBase | protected |
| Close() | CMenuToolbarBase | |
| CMenuToolbarBase(CMenuBand *menuBand, BOOL usePager) | CMenuToolbarBase | |
| CreateToolbar(HWND hwndParent, DWORD dwFlags) | CMenuToolbarBase | |
| DisableMouseTrack(BOOL bDisable) | CMenuToolbarBase | |
| ExecuteItem() | CMenuToolbarBase | |
| FillToolbar(BOOL clearFirst=FALSE)=0 | CMenuToolbarBase | pure virtual |
| GetDataFromId(INT iItem, INT *pIndex, DWORD_PTR *pData) | CMenuToolbarBase | |
| GetSizes(SIZE *pMinSize, SIZE *pMaxSize, SIZE *pIntegralSize) | CMenuToolbarBase | |
| GetToolbar() | CMenuToolbarBase | inlineprotected |
| GetWindow(HWND *phwnd) | CMenuToolbarBase | |
| InternalContextMenu(INT iItem, INT index, DWORD_PTR dwData, POINT pt) PURE | CMenuToolbarBase | protectedvirtual |
| InternalExecuteItem(INT iItem, INT index, DWORD_PTR dwData) PURE | CMenuToolbarBase | protectedvirtual |
| InternalGetTooltip(INT iItem, INT index, DWORD_PTR dwData, LPWSTR pszText, INT cchTextMax) PURE | CMenuToolbarBase | protectedvirtual |
| InternalHasSubMenu(INT iItem, INT index, DWORD_PTR dwData) PURE | CMenuToolbarBase | protectedvirtual |
| InternalPopupItem(INT iItem, INT index, DWORD_PTR dwData, BOOL keyInitiated) PURE | CMenuToolbarBase | protectedvirtual |
| InvalidateDraw() | CMenuToolbarBase | |
| IsTrackedItem(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L &bHandled) | CMenuToolbarBase | private |
| IsWindowOwner(HWND hwnd) | CMenuToolbarBase | |
| KeyboardItemChange(DWORD changeType) | CMenuToolbarBase | |
| KillPopupTimer() | CMenuToolbarBase | |
| m_cancelingPopup | CMenuToolbarBase | protected |
| m_disableMouseTrack | CMenuToolbarBase | private |
| m_dwMenuFlags | CMenuToolbarBase | protected |
| m_executeData | CMenuToolbarBase | protected |
| m_executeIndex | CMenuToolbarBase | protected |
| m_executeItem | CMenuToolbarBase | protected |
| m_hasSizes | CMenuToolbarBase | protected |
| m_hotBar | CMenuToolbarBase | protected |
| m_hotItem | CMenuToolbarBase | protected |
| m_idealSize | CMenuToolbarBase | protected |
| m_initFlags | CMenuToolbarBase | protected |
| m_isTrackingPopup | CMenuToolbarBase | protected |
| m_itemSize | CMenuToolbarBase | protected |
| m_marlett | CMenuToolbarBase | private |
| m_menuBand | CMenuToolbarBase | protected |
| m_pager | CMenuToolbarBase | private |
| m_popupBar | CMenuToolbarBase | protected |
| m_popupItem | CMenuToolbarBase | protected |
| m_timerEnabled | CMenuToolbarBase | private |
| m_useFlatMenus | CMenuToolbarBase | private |
| m_usePager | CMenuToolbarBase | protected |
| MenuBarMouseDown(INT iIndex, BOOL isLButton) | CMenuToolbarBase | |
| MenuBarMouseUp(INT iIndex, BOOL isLButton) | CMenuToolbarBase | |
| OnCustomDraw(LPNMTBCUSTOMDRAW cdraw, LRESULT *theResult) | CMenuToolbarBase | private |
| OnDeletingButton(const NMTOOLBAR *tb) PURE | CMenuToolbarBase | protectedvirtual |
| OnGetInfoTip(NMTBGETINFOTIP *tip) | CMenuToolbarBase | private |
| OnPagerCalcSize(LPNMPGCALCSIZE csize) | CMenuToolbarBase | private |
| OnPopupTimer(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L &bHandled) | CMenuToolbarBase | private |
| OnWinEvent(HWND hWnd, UINT uMsg, WPARAM wParam, LPARAM lParam, LRESULT *theResult) | CMenuToolbarBase | |
| OnWinEventWrap(UINT uMsg, WPARAM wParam, LPARAM lParam, BOOL &bHandled) | CMenuToolbarBase | private |
| PopupItem(INT iItem, BOOL keyInitiated) | CMenuToolbarBase | |
| PopupSubMenu(UINT itemId, UINT index, IShellMenu *childShellMenu, BOOL keyInitiated) | CMenuToolbarBase | |
| PopupSubMenu(UINT itemId, UINT index, HMENU menu) | CMenuToolbarBase | |
| PrepareExecuteItem(INT iItem) | CMenuToolbarBase | |
| ProcessClick(INT iItem) | CMenuToolbarBase | |
| ProcessContextMenu(INT iItem) | CMenuToolbarBase | |
| SetPosSize(int x, int y, int cx, int cy) | CMenuToolbarBase | |
| ShowDW(BOOL fShow) | CMenuToolbarBase | |
| TrackContextMenu(IContextMenu *contextMenu, POINT pt) | CMenuToolbarBase | |
| UpdateImageLists() | CMenuToolbarBase | private |
| ~CMenuToolbarBase() | CMenuToolbarBase | virtual |